The FA Futsal Cup finals make a return to the iconic Copper Box Arena in Stratford this weekend, providing an atmospheric demonstration of futsal and featuring an assortment of the best male and female teams in the country.

Over 600 sides have competed in the qualifiers to win the right to challenge in the National Finals. The privileged finalists at the Olympic 2012 venue get the opportunity to test their skills over two days of tough competition to be crowned men’s and women’s cup winners.

Also taking place this month and in July are football skills and coaching for children with disabilities aged 8-16. This is part of two features occurring at Barking Abbey School at their brand new Disability Football Centre.

Participants will be supported to learn new skills at their own pace and visually or hearing impaired Cerebral Palsy and amputee players, as well as individuals with a learning disability, are welcome to play on the 3G pitch from 10am to 12pm for six Saturday starting from June 20.
